为什么要使用vue.js

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    使用Vue.js的原因有以下几点:

    1. 简单易学:Vue.js拥有简洁的API和直观的语法,使得学习和使用它变得十分容易。即使是对于初学者来说,也可以迅速上手并使用Vue.js构建交互性强、响应式的Web界面。

    2. 双向数据绑定:Vue.js采用了MVVM(Model-View-ViewModel)的架构模式,通过双向的数据绑定机制,实现了数据与视图的自动同步。当数据发生变化时,视图会自动更新,而当用户与视图进行交互时,数据也会自动更新。

    3. 组件化开发:Vue.js鼓励开发者将界面拆分成多个独立、可复用的组件。每个组件内部包含了自己的HTML、CSS和JavaScript,这样可以极大地提高代码的可维护性和复用性。同时,Vue.js提供了丰富的组件库和生态系统,开发者可以快速搭建出复杂的Web应用。

    4. 高效性能:Vue.js采用了虚拟DOM技术,在数据发生变化时,会只重新渲染发生变化的部分,从而避免了不必要的性能开销。此外,Vue.js还采用了异步渲染和组件级别的懒加载等性能优化策略,保证了应用的高效性能。

    5. 生态系统丰富:Vue.js拥有庞大的社区和生态系统,开发者可以轻松获取到各种插件、工具和解决方案来满足各种需求。此外,Vue.js也与其他流行的前端库和框架(如Vue Router和Vuex)无缝整合,使得开发更加便捷。

    综上所述,由于Vue.js的简单易学、双向数据绑定、组件化开发、高效性能以及丰富的生态系统,使得它成为一款非常受欢迎的前端框架。无论是初学者还是经验丰富的开发者,都可以通过使用Vue.js来构建出高质量的Web应用。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    使用Vue.js的原因有以下几点:

    1. 简单易学:Vue.js是一种简单易学的JavaScript框架,具有清晰的API和逻辑,使开发过程更加容易。凭借其直观的语法和简洁的模板语法,可以快速上手并构建出高质量的应用程序。

    2. 响应式UI:Vue.js采用了响应式的数据绑定机制,当数据发生变化时,相关的视图会自动更新,大大简化了开发过程。开发人员只需要关注数据的变化,而不需要手动操作DOM。

    3. 组件化开发:Vue.js将UI界面拆分为多个独立的组件,每个组件可以拥有自己的状态和行为。这样可以实现代码的复用,提高开发效率。同时,组件化开发也让代码更加可读性和可维护性。

    4. 支持单文件组件:Vue.js可以使用单文件组件(.vue文件)来组织代码,将HTML、CSS和JavaScript集中在一个文件中。这样可以使代码更加模块化,易于管理和维护。

    5. 生态系统丰富:Vue.js拥有一个活跃的开源社区,有大量的插件和工具可用于扩展和增强其功能。比如,Vue Router用于处理前端路由,Vuex用于管理应用程序的状态,Vuetify等UI库用于构建漂亮的界面等。这些插件和工具可以大大简化开发过程,提高开发效率。

    综上所述,使用Vue.js可以使开发过程更加简单、快速和高效。它的响应式UI、组件化开发和丰富的生态系统使得构建高质量的应用程序变得更加容易。如果您是一个前端开发人员,Vue.js是一个非常值得学习和使用的框架。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    使用Vue.js的原因有以下几点:

    1. 简单易用:Vue.js具有易于理解和上手的语法,采用了基于HTML的模板语法,可以快速构建界面。通过简单的指令和数据绑定,可以实现复杂的应用逻辑,使开发者能够专注于业务逻辑而无需过多关注底层实现。

    2. 响应式数据驱动:Vue.js采用了基于数据驱动的视图组件模型,能够自动追踪数据的变化并相应地更新DOM。开发者只需要关注数据的变化,界面的更新会自动完成,大大简化了开发流程。

    3. 组件化开发:Vue.js提供了组件化的开发结构,将页面上的各个功能区域进行模块化封装,提高了代码的可复用性和维护性。同时,Vue.js的组件系统与现有的库或项目很容易进行集成,使得开发者可以选择使用已有的组件来快速构建界面。

    4. 轻量级:Vue.js的核心库只有24KB,加载速度快,同时也不依赖其他三方库,使得Vue.js成为一个轻量级的框架,方便在现有项目中集成。

    5. 社区活跃:Vue.js在开源社区中拥有庞大而活跃的用户群体,因此其生态系统也非常丰富。开发者能够从社区中获取到大量的插件和工具,帮助开发者更加高效地开发项目。

    下面是使用Vue.js的简单操作流程:

    1. 引入Vue.js库:在项目中引入Vue.js的核心库,可以通过直接下载文件引入,也可以使用CDN进行引入。

    2. 创建Vue实例:在页面上需要使用Vue.js的地方,创建一个Vue实例来托管这部分的逻辑。可以通过实例化Vue类来创建Vue实例,也可以使用Vue构造函数传入一个选项对象来创建实例。

    3. 定义数据:在Vue实例的data选项中定义需要响应式的数据。这些数据将会与视图进行绑定,在数据发生变化时,视图也会自动更新。

    4. 编写模板:使用Vue.js的模板语法编写页面的HTML模板。可以在模板中使用表达式、指令和过滤器等来实现数据的渲染和交互。

    5. 绑定数据:使用双向绑定指令v-model将数据和用户的输入绑定在一起,当用户输入改变时,数据也会相应地更新。

    6. 定义方法:在Vue实例的methods选项中定义需要在模板中使用的方法。这些方法可以用来响应用户的交互行为,修改数据,并触发视图的更新。

    7. 实现组件化:将页面上的某些功能区域抽象为Vue组件,定义组件的属性和方法,并在需要使用组件的地方进行引用。

    8. 执行渲染:将Vue实例挂载到页面上的目标元素上,完成页面的渲染。

    9. 监听事件:使用Vue提供的事件系统,监听DOM元素上的事件,通过触发事件方法来实现用户的交互逻辑。

    10. 编写样式:使用CSS对页面进行样式的美化,可以通过Vue提供的class和style绑定来实现样式的动态变化。

    11. 编写逻辑:根据业务需求,在Vue实例的生命周期钩子函数中编写需要执行的代码,如created、mounted等。

    12. 打包部署:使用工具对项目进行打包,将相关文件整合到一个或多个静态资源文件中,然后将这些文件部署到服务器上。

    以上是使用Vue.js的简单操作流程,开发者可以根据实际项目需求进行操作。在实践中,通过不断学习和探索,可以深入了解Vue.js的更多特性和用法,进一步提高开发效率和代码质量。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部